Provided by Rotary Yoneyama Foundation
Rotary Yoneyama is Japan's largest private scholarship foundation, with an overseas-candidate track for students still in their home country who are scheduled to enrol at a Japanese university. The stipend is ¥100,000–¥140,000/month depending on level, plus up to ¥250,000 travel reimbursement. Recipients join the Rotary community in Japan.
For students still overseas who are scheduled to enrol at a Japanese university or graduate school. JLPT N3 or above required at the time of application. You must find and apply to the Japanese university yourself first and submit a copy of that application. Graduate applicants need a recommendation letter from a supervisor at the target graduate school. Research students are not eligible.
For students still overseas who have applied to (or will apply to) a Japanese university and can demonstrate JLPT N3 or higher. The catch: you must secure your own university admission first, and graduate applicants need a supervisor recommendation from the target school.
